react-three-fiber vs Bluebird: What are the differences?

What is react-three-fiber? A React renderer for Three.js (web and react-native). It is a React renderer for Threejs on the web and react-native. Rendering performance is up to Threejs and the GPU. Components participate in the renderloop outside of React, without any additional overhead.

What is Bluebird? A full featured promise library with unmatched performance. It is a fully-featured promise library with a focus on innovative features and performance.

react-three-fiber belongs to "Game Development" category of the tech stack, while Bluebird can be primarily classified under "Javascript Utilities & Libraries".

react-three-fiber and Bluebird are both open source tools. Bluebird with 19.2K GitHub stars and 2.35K forks on GitHub appears to be more popular than react-three-fiber with 9.24K GitHub stars and 418 GitHub forks.
